The old town ("vieille ville") is large, old, and extremely interesting. Tiny streets wind forever between the 17th and 18th century buildings, up and down ancient steps, passing through arched tunnels and sometimes opening out onto large squares.
The principal square near the top of the old town is the Place aux Aires, with a daily market of flowers and regional foods. A pretty, three-tiered fountain splashes in the center of the flowers, and arcades line one long side.
To the south, only 15 km away, is the city of Cannes with its yachts, fine-sand beaches and luxury shopping.
World renowned for its glitzy exterior, Cannes is also a place of great cultural heritage. On a small hill above the port of Cannes is "le Souquet", Cannes' oldest quarter. During the 11th Century this was inhabited by the monks from Îles de Lerins after their island was raided by Saracens. Watch towers now provide views over the Mediterranean.

Nearby Antibes (Cap d'Antibes & Juan-les-Pins) is located on the Mediterranean coast, between Cannes and Nice. It is the third largest town on the Côte d'Azur. Its name comes from the Greek 'Antipolis' which means 'opposite' (here, facing the city of Nice).
This is where the very rich and the very successful gather. All amenities with many pretty squares and narrow streets. Traditional markets and pavement cafés and restaurants. Excellent nightlife.
Despite its glamorous location, Antibes is relatively un-touristy. It is primarily a yachting town. Port Vauban is truly the centre of Mediterranean yachting. Worth a visit just to look at the boats on 'millionaires row'.
Marineland is the biggest marine show in Europe with dolphins, whales and sea-lions etc. Large water-park, 'Aquasplash' with water-chutes, wave pool and further attractions.
Picasso Museum with more than 50 original works.
